Cutting will require some advanced lapidary skills and possible backing to prevent cracking. Matrix is hard, but unseen fissures may exist in this type of material. Size: About 3.5" x 2.5" x 2.25 (at longest, widest and thickest measurements - varying). Location of discovery: Ray Mine, AZ. (pre-90's - depleted source). Items not returnable unless noted. Specimen and Lapidary Hazards: Many rocks and minerals (specimens) contain potentially hazardous or allergenic compounds, some known or unknown.

Some specimens (as noted) may be coated with polyurethane to provide a wet look. Specimens should never be applied to skin or ingested. Lapidary work should always be preformed with safety equipment including inhalation and skin contact considerations.

Specimens should not be used in aquariums or terrariums without establishing safety first. Do not allow children to handle specimens.
